A MAN was arrested on suspicion of assault for his role in a disturbance outside a pub which saw a woman attacked.

Police were called to the incident outside the Prince of Wales in Quaker Lane, Darwen, on Friday night.

It is believed an officer had to draw their Taser during the disturbance but it was not discharged.

A 39-year-old woman from Blackburn was arrested on suspicion of being drunk and disorderly. She was given a fixed a penalty notice.

A woman is her 20s was attacked and police said she was treated at the scene by paramedics.

A 21-year-old man from Darwen was arrested on suspicion of causing actual bodily harm.

A police spokesman said: “It looks like we were called at approximately 11pm on October 29 to Quaker Lane, Darwen, to reports of an assault.

“Officers found a large group had left a nearby pub and during the ensuing disturbance a man was seen attempting to punch a woman.

“A 21-year-old man from Darwen arrested on suspicion of assault but released no charge.

“A 39-year-old woman from Blackburn was arrested on suspicion of being drunk and disorderly. She has since received a penalty notice.”
